I confess that I'm puzzled. I don't think that the ad is "from" AW. Our ad lists do not list Nordstroms. The way the ad functions is such that it violates the contracts our ad services have with us and with ad providers.
The ad in question:
1. Is a Nordstrom ad for shoes or frangrance.
2. The ad appears in a new tab.
3. The ad appears either from after clicking a New Posts link or clicking on a thread title (1 instance).
4. The ad appears for users on OS X and various flavors of Windows, using Firefox and Safari.
5. I've been using Firefox and Safari and trying to get the ad to display. I can't.
6. I can't find a link on AW that plants a redirect cookie, or a similarly functioning graphic or webbug.
7. Logging off, deleting cookies, emptying the cache and history seem to solve the problem temporarily, but the ad returns a day or two later.
At this point I'm wondering about one or more other sites planting the redirect that is then triggered while browsing AW because the people seeing the ad are all regular readers of AW.
It is happening elsewhere; I'm on touch with a number of other admins with the same concerns and no answers. None of the other sites I know of that are seeing the ad are writing sites, or I'd point to a common writing site as the vector.
It's not dangerous or malicious as far as I can determine, just annoying, and I don't like it happening to AW members.
